Why pick a 7K at all?
Every legal big-puff kit in the UK works the same way since the disposables ban: a rechargeable device fed by a 2ml pod plus a sealed reservoir, all at the 20mg (2%) legal cap (how that's legal, explained). Within that format, 7K devices hit a specific niche: enough liquid for one to two weeks of moderate vaping, but small, light and cheap enough that losing one on a night out isn't a tragedy. If a BM6000 runs out too fast for you but a 25K brick feels like carrying a power bank, this is your bracket.
1. Hayati Rubik 7000 — the quality pick
| Spec | Value |
|---|---|
| Puffs | Up to 7,000 |
| Liquid | ~12ml (2ml pod + 10ml reservoir) |
| Battery | 850mAh, USB-C |
| Coil | Dual mesh, MTL draw |
| Nicotine | 20mg nic salt |
The Rubik's-cube-inspired design is a genuine talking point, but the reason it wins this bracket is the dual mesh coil and the 12ml of liquid — the flavour stays crisp deeper into the device's life than anything else at the price. 2. Elux Firerose Alter 7K — the budget pick
| Spec | Value |
|---|---|
| Puffs | Up to 7,000 |
| Liquid | 7ml (2ml pod + 5ml reservoir) |
| Battery | Rechargeable, USB-C |
| Nicotine | 20mg nic salt |
| Typical price | £5–£8 |
Elux's compact entry — from the same house as the Legend nic salts half the UK vapes — is the cheapest sensible route into a big-puff kit, and the flavours carry that Elux e-liquid pedigree. The honest trade-off: 7ml of liquid versus the Rubik's 12ml means the "7,000 puffs" is more optimistic here, and the smaller reservoir empties noticeably sooner for a heavy vaper. Frequently Asked Questions
Are 7,000-puff vapes legal in the UK?
Yes — legal 7K devices are rechargeable pod kits with a 2ml pod plus a reservoir, at 20mg nicotine or under. It's sealed single-use disposables that were banned in June 2025, not big puff counts.
How long does a 7,000-puff vape last?
For a typical moderate vaper, one to two weeks. Heavy vapers will land nearer a week — puff-count ratings are lab maximums, and real-world draw length matters more than the number on the box.
Which is better, the Hayati Rubik 7000 or the Firerose Alter 7K?
The Rubik is the better device — 12ml of liquid vs 7ml, and a dual mesh coil that holds flavour longer. The Firerose wins purely on price at £5–£8. Both run 20mg nic salt and charge over USB-C.
Is a 7K vape better than a Lost Mary BM6000?
Different jobs: the BM6000 is the beginner-friendly default with the biggest flavour range; a 7K roughly doubles the liquid on board for similar money. If you're reordering BM6000s every few days, stepping up to a 7K or a T9000 saves money.
Do 7,000-puff vapes need charging?
Yes — that's what makes them legal. Expect to top up over USB-C every day or two; the liquid outlasts the battery charge by design.
